Amla Pickle Recipe

This amla and chillies pickle is easy to make, nutritious, and yummy. It is the best way to get the health benefits of amla.
Ingredients
  • Amla - 250 gms
  • Mustard Oil - 100 ml
  • Methi seeds – ½ tsp
  • Salt – according to taste
  • Turmeric powder – 1tsp
  • Red chilli powder – ½ tsp
  • Mustard seeds/rai- ½ tsp
  • Fennel seeds /saunf - 1 teaspoons
  • Jeera – ½ tsp
  • Green chillies (slit) optional
Instructions
  1. First of all, wash and dry amlas and boil them in water until they are soft. You can add turmeric and salt to the water. (half quantity)
  2. Once done, strain the amlas and let them cool and then remove the seeds and take out the florets.
  3. Now heat mustard oil in a pan, let it heat till boiling point and then cool for 2 mins. Now add mustard seeds, jeera and saunf to the oil and let it cook properly.
  4. Once done, add amlas and green chillies to the mixture. Mix it nicely and then add red chilly powder, salt and haldi to the mixture and mix nicely till amlas and chillies are nicely coated.
  5. The pickle is ready! Just let it cool for some time before storing it in a glass jar. Enjoy it with your meals.
Notes
Make sure there is no water in the green chillies or otherwise. Moisture is not good for the pickle. So, wipe the glass jar too properly before storing the pickle.

If the weather is warm, you can keep the pickle in the refrigerator.

Green chillies are optional.
